Altium_Protel99SE的使用
时间:2023-05-04 23:37:00
目录:
Protel99SE的使用
一、WIN7手动添加库文件
1.方法1:通过修改ini文件
2.方法二:原理图通过库搜索
二、Protel99SE文件瘦身
三、绘制原理图
1.电子元件镜像
2.拖动电子元件
3.复制粘贴电子元件
4.元件封装全局修改
5、放置元件子件
6.在原理图中创建图纸模板
7.将图片插入原理图中
8.编辑引脚的低电平有效符号
9.快速查找同名网络标号
10、SCH自动编号元件,消除重复元件
走线为虚线
12.在原理图库中生成和修改元件snap
13.选择原理图PCB板上的元件
14.跟随移动元件导线
99、ERC
四、PCB图绘制
1、Protel99SE选择和删除线段
2、Protel99SE英制与公制的切换
3、Protel99SE按键盘PT调出画线功能
4、Protel99SE拼板的详细图解
1)设置原点 2)复制粘贴PCB板 3)增加Mark点
4)用队列粘贴 5)Docunment Options中去掉DRC Errors规则错误和Connettion预拉线
5、Protel99SE画任意线段
6、Protel99SE当元件放置在另一个直插元件的背面时,它总是变成绿色解决方案
7、Protel99SE生产特殊焊盘
8、Protel99SE或AD10线路板旋转任何角度
9、Protel99SE镜像PCB
10、Protel99SE_PCB板添加汉字
11、Protel99SE_PCB降低成本的方法
12、Protel99SE快速的查找PCB中间的电子元件
13、Protel99SE_PCB制作LOGO(制作LOGO)
14.删除图层中的画线
15.快速调整元件标号的方向
16.增加焊盘的眼泪
17.跟随移动元件导线
99、DRC
五、原理图或PCB快速生成BOM物料清单
1.按原理图输出BOM
2、PCB里利用CAM Manager输出BOM
3.在绘制原理图时输出TXT格式BOM清单
六、Protel99SE图纸的打印
1、Protel99SE原理图打印
1)设置原理图大小 2)设置打印机
2、Protel99SE印版图打印
1)在FILE菜单下单击PRINT/PREVIEW预览文成预览文档 2)Protell99SE中PCB打印的设置 3)1:1显示和打印
七、Protel99SE出错处理
1、自动弹出Network License Authorization对话框
2、Protel99se打开PCB十字光标出现在板上
3.生成原理图PCB报错
八、Protel99SE根据电路功能块布局方便
九、Protel99SE的覆铜
1、覆铜后看不到覆铜层,显示或隐藏铺铜(依次O P)
2、无法复制覆铜层
3、增加与焊盘连线的宽度
十、Protel99SE将PCB文件转CAD(Protel99与AutoCAD之DXF文件)
十一、Protel99se_PCB板顶层和底层互换
1、通过机械层作中介互换顶层和低层(Protel99se_PCB板顶层和底层互换)
2、通过复制/特殊粘贴再L快捷键
十二、生成GerBer文件
十三、Protel99SE从原有图纸生成自己的元件库
1、生成自己的原理图库
2、生成自己的PCB板库
附录
一、库文件
1、常用原理图库文件
2、设计说明和尺寸要求
3、库文件的管理
二、分立元件库元件名称及中英对照
三、PCB印刷线路板各层含义
四、关于MARK点的小知识
1、MARK点的分类
2、设计说明和尺寸要求
五、元件封装的确定
1、通过嘉立创商城
2、通过百度、淘宝、阿里巴巴搜索相关封装
3、通过实物自行建立
4、通过Proteus仿真软件
-----------------------------------------------------------------------------------------------------------
Protel99SE的使用
一、WIN7手动添加库文件
1、方法一:通过修改ini文件
1)在win7下正确安装Protell99SE,相关文件搜索我的百度云盘。
2)运行一次Protell99SE,会发现原理图和PCB各已经添了一个库,但是却不能再添加系统默认的别的库(更别说自定义的库了) 。
3)接下来找到C盘(系统盘),系统文件夹(C:\windows)下的ADVSch99SE.ini(原理图库)和ADVPCB99SE.ini(PCB封装库)文件[每个文件就几K大小]。
4)我们先配置原理图,用记事本打开ADVSch99S.ini文件,在[Change Library File List]下找到File0,大家可以发现,等号后面的的内容就是默认已经添加的库,把这个改为我们自定义的库(记得路径要正确),再打开99,发现默认添加的就是我们的库了,如果要添加多个怎么办呢?简单,依样画葫芦,在File0后面添File1,File2..依次类推,但注意最后修改File0上面的Count值,如果一共有两个库,就把它的值改为3.举个例子:
Count=3
File0=D:\Program Files\Design Explorer 99 SE\Library\Sch\Miscellaneous Devices.ddb
File1=D:\Program Files\Design Explorer 99 SE\Library\Sch\SHCLIB.ddb
File2=D:\Program Files\Design Explorer 99 SE\Library\Sch\Protel DOS Schematic Libraries.ddb
5)然后让我们修改PCB的库配置,同样用记事本打开ADVPCB99SE.ini文件,在[PCB Libraries](注意是英文的,不是中文的[PCB库](汉化后会有中文[PCB库]))下找到File0进行修改或添加:
Count=3
File0=D>MSACCESS:$RP>D:\Program Files\Design Explorer 99 SE\Library\Pcb\Generic Footprints$RN>Advpcb.ddb$OP>$ON>PCB Footprints.lib$ID>-1$ATTR>0$E>PCBLIB$STF>
File1=D>MSACCESS:$RP>D:\Program Files\Design Explorer 99 SE\Library\Pcb\Generic Footprints$RN>Advpcb.ddb$OP>$ON>MyPCB.LIB$ID>-1$ATTR>0$E>PCBLIB$STF>
File2=D>MSACCESS:$RP>D:\Program Files\Design Explorer 99 SE\Library\Pcb\Generic Footprints$RN>Advpcb.ddb$OP>$ON>SMD series.lib$ID>-1$ATTR>0$E>PCBLIB$STF>
最下面也有一个File0,一并更改。
PCB库的修改稍烦,大家必须知道DDB文件里具体PCB库的文件名才行,如Adcpcb.DDB的库文件名为Footprint.lib。不知道库文件名的打开.DDB文件就知道了。把自己的两个库添加到Adcpcb.DDB,如下操作。
提示:建议把你自定义的库放到PROTEL默认的库中进行添加,这样修改配置时就会容易些。如我的PROTEL装在D盘Program Files目录下,那么默认的原理图库位置为:
D:\Program Files\Design Explorer 99 SE\Library\Sch\
默认的PCB库位置为:
D:\Program Files\Design Explorer 99 SE\Library\Pcb\Generic Footprints\
-------------------
注:将Protel99SE安装于“D:\Program Files\Design Explorer 99 SE”
自己的原理图库文件加载到:D:\Program Files\Design Explorer 99 SE\Library\Sch
自己的PCB图库文件加载到:D:\Program Files\Design Explorer 99 SE\Library\Pcb\Generic Footprints
-------------------
2、方法二:原理图通过库查找
-------------------------
二、Protel99SE文件瘦身
在使用Protel99SE的时候,有没有感觉到设计文件会随操作次数的增加,文件变的越来越大,最后可以达到几十乃至上百M,占咱们宝贵的资源不说,打开的时候还非常的慢。
打开主菜单file旁边箭头处的菜单的子菜单的disign utilities选项。
在弹出的对话框中选中perform compact after closing(关闭时瘦身)然后关闭对话框就行了。
-------------------------
三、原理图绘制
1、电子元件镜像
鼠标左键点住三极管,左右镜像Ctrl+X,上下镜像Ctrl+Y,如下图。同样适用于PCB板。
----------------------------
2、电子元件的拖动
鼠标点一下元器件,按住Ctrl不放,拖动鼠标,元器件上的连线会跟着一起动。
----------------------------
3、电子元件的复制与粘贴
按住Shift键不放,再去点元件,元件变成黄色。
这样就可以进行复制粘贴操作了,键盘EEA取消选择。
框选将选中一大片片。
----------------------------
4、全局修改元件封装
比如下面这样就会把RES2的封装为R0805全部修改为0805,类似可以全局修改PCB中字体样式和大小等。
----------------------------
5、放置元件子件如下图:
比如显示LM358的另一半
----------------------------
6、在原理图中创建图纸模板
1)创建一个.dot文件,例如“高频变压器图纸样式.dot”
2)执行菜单命令Design/Options,设置图纸大小(注意:模板只应用于相对应大小图纸上),取消Title Block选项。
3)用画图工具栏里的直线画标题栏,直线颜色设置为黑色(按Tab)
4)再放入文字之前,取消菜单View/Snap Grid的锁定,便于放文字,文字大小设置为三号黑。
5)在相应的位置输入“.TITLE”“.REVISION”等字符(注意:输入这些字符前取消菜单Tools/preference中的Convert Special Strings)
6)字符对应表
.ORGANIZATION 设计单位
.ADDRESS1 单位地址
.ADDRESS2
.ADDRESS3
.ADDRESS4
.SHEETNUMBE 当前图纸号
.SHEETTOTA 图纸总数
.TITLE 当前文档名称
.DOCUMENTNUMBER 当前文档号码
.REVISION 设计版本
输入完相应字符后再选中菜单Tools/preference中的Convert Special Strings
7)若想在原理图纸中调用此模板,执行菜单命令Design/Template/Set Template File Name
----------------------------
7、在原理图中插入图片
按键P-D-G,就会弹出一个对话框,找到要插入的图片,点打开按钮,鼠标上出现一个图片的外框,点一下起点,拉鼠标点一下终点,好了,图片就插入到原理图上了,还可以点图片调整大小的。
注:原理图移走时,图片也要跟着移走,所以放在同一目录中是最好的方法。
----------------------------
8、编辑引脚的低电平有效的符号
双击编辑引脚时,在 Name 中,每个字母后面加\----------------------------
9、快速查找同名网络标号
按快捷键Ctrl+F,出来对话框后输入要找的网络标号,按OK就能找到一个,再按F3则继续找下一个。
----------------------------
10、SCH元器件自动编号,消除重复元器件
操作菜单tools/annotate或快捷键T、A,出现annotate对话框,左键点Options选项,这时对话框上部有个Annotate Options 空白栏,点空白栏右边下拉黑三角,选择All Parts(熟练后可选择其它)。对话框中部的小空白框可不作选择。对话框左下角有4种打点选择,是选择编号在电路图的先后顺序排列的走向,你按需要选一种即可。做好上述设置后,点击最下方的OK即可。
先点“Reset Designators”,然后再点“?Parts”,如下图
进行原理图ERC检查,即可以检出包括是否有元件重名等原理性问题。
----------------------------
11、走线为虚线
快捷键P+W 随便找一个位置鼠标左键随便点一个位置,按空格键改变线的走线状态就可以了。转换好了再左击一下就OK了。
----------------------------
12、原理图库中生成和修改元件的snap
----------------------------
13、通过原理图选择PCB板上的元件
1)通过
Cross Probe针对单个元件,同理PCB也可作同等操作。
2)多个元件的操作。
----------------------------
14、移动元件导线跟随
Edit\Move\Drag菜单功能,按住CTRL再点击需要移动的元件。
----------------------------
99、ERC
----------------------
四、PCB的绘制
1、Protel99SE选中和删除线段
Protel99SE键盘SP后,鼠标变成一个“十字”,
可以选择线,选中后线变白。
按Ctrl+Delete删除线段。
----------------------------
2、Protel99SE英制与公制的切换
Protel99SE按Q可以切换英制Imperial和公制Metric,或者鼠标右键Option/Board Options中
----------------------------
3、Protel99SE按键盘PT调出画线功能
----------------------------
4、Protel99SE拼板的详细图解
1)设置原点
首先打开PCB文档。如图所示:电路板的原点并没有在边上,为了操作方便和规范,先把有点设置到板框的边上。
操作如下现在下方的板框,查看属性。如下图:放置一个焊盘到X =0,Y=-2.9718位置。
点击菜单Edit—Origin—Set ,鼠标点选择X =0,Y=-2.9718位置焊盘点,完成了重新设置了原点的操作。
从下图看,为了方便电路板生产厂家的加工和焊接工厂的加工,拼版的方向是向上Y轴方向拼版。
接着为了在拼版过程中好对齐板边,所以需要在Y轴的顶边放置一个选择焊盘,用于拼版时电路板的放置。
电路板生产工艺中无间隙拼版的间隙0.5mm左右 工艺边不能低于5mm .,那么定位焊盘位置就是Y轴板边高度加0.127MM。
如下图Y轴高18.5,那么在板边上放置一个X=0, Y=18.627的焊盘。
效果如下图:
--------------
2)复制粘贴PCB板
全选电路板,并复制电路板,复制电路板的时候,鼠标点到X=0,Y=0原点上。
然后选择菜单栏中的paste special (特殊粘贴,使用特殊粘贴,可以保证拼板不会自动重命名。),在弹出的对话框中勾选 Keep net narr 和Duolicate design 两项,如下图二所示。
点击Paste ,鼠标的光标移动Y轴X=0, Y=18.627的焊盘的中点。就完成的无缝拼版。如图:
拼版线就刚好是0.508mm.满足了做板工艺有求。在去掉为了方便拼板所加的两个焊盘,就大功告成了。
--------------
3)增加Mark点
有时候为了方便SMT生产,一般都会在板两边多加5MM的工艺边,并在对角放置MARK点。
如图加了两个Mark点(因为本例子上有合适的位置加Mark点,所以并没有外加5MM的工艺边)。
--------------
4)使用队列粘贴
当我重新浏览了网页,我忽略了另外一个更加简单的拼板方法,就是使用队列粘贴。我把方法也写出来。
打开PCB电路板。安装上面的方法设置好电路板的原点。查看原点外的板边框尺寸,如图:
如果以Y轴拼板,那么等下就会用到Y=44.196+0.127=44.323.如果以X轴拼板,那么就用到X==97.79+0.127=97.917.
为什么会计算这两个尺寸呢?因为在队列粘贴中用到这两个参数进行板到下块板的距离。
全选电路板,复制电路板时,复制选择十字光标一定要在电路板的原点上,进行复制。
选择菜单栏中的Edit—Paste Special,然后选择菜单栏中的paste special
(特殊粘贴,使用特殊粘贴,可以保证拼板不会自动重命名。),在弹出的对话框中勾选 Keep net narr 和Duolicate design 两项,如下图二所示,并点击Paste Array。
弹出如图对话框:
其中Item Coun指向X轴或Y轴方向(只能取一个方向)拼板的数量;
X-Spanin指向X轴方向拼板,负值左方向,正值右方向,具体数值没多大意义;
Y-Spanin指向Y轴方向拼板,负值下方向,正值上方向,具体数值没多大意义。
删除原PCB,两边各加5MM的板边和MARK,就完成了拼板。
为了显示清楚,去掉DRC和飞线方法如下图,选择菜单栏中的Design —Options
--------------
5)Docunment Options中去掉DRC Errors规则错误和Connettion预拉线
----------------------------
5、Protel99SE画任意线段
如下图,按住shift+space键切换。
----------------------------
6、Protel99SE元件放置到另一个直插元件背面时总是变成绿色的解决
1)取消Component Clearance的选项即可。
--------------
2)再点Run DRC,如下图:
----------------------------
7、Protel99SE特殊焊盘的制作
1)焊盘过孔呈长方形
(1)放一个的焊盘。
(2)设置好大小。